Got to Beck late after again getting el zippo at another locale. I was hoping for something, anything to make me believe again
This spring (should we even call it that) has truly sucked. Most trips have ended the same, no fish.
I'd lost my last 'trap previously, casting it off somehow. It'd have to be plastics today. Wacky rigged a 5" baby bass senko which has seemed to be the most popular color at Beck. About five casts in my line actually moved! Out of sheer instinct I set the hook and reeled in a mediumish but extreeemly welcome bass. I was in such shock I took this terrible selfie. Note shocked look:
Several minutes later I hooked into a rocket bass... it was swimming so fast right to left I barely got a set in; it came unbuttoned unseen. Seemed to be a good one.
A guy came by and I told him it seemed the fish were finally moving again and to prove my point he nailed on on maybe his third cast with a white twister tail gig. Looked to be a nice and fat one but it self released about five feet out.
I made a few more casts and, with a sigh of relief, headed home.
